Illinois SB 839 (103rd) — SAFETY-TECH

Amends the Illinois Premise Alert Program (PAP) Act. Makes a technical change in a Section concerning the short title.

Timeline

The legislative action history — every referral, reading, and vote.

  • 2023-02-02 Filed with Secretary by Sen. Don Harmon filing
  • 2023-02-02 First Reading reading-1
  • 2023-02-02 Referred to Assignments
  • 2023-03-02 Assigned to Executive referral-committee
  • 2023-03-09 Do Pass Executive; 011-000-000
  • 2023-03-09 Placed on Calendar Order of 2nd Reading March 10, 2023 reading-2
  • 2023-03-10 Second Reading reading-2
  • 2023-03-10 Placed on Calendar Order of 3rd Reading March 21, 2023
  • 2023-03-31 Rule 3-9(a) / Re-referred to Assignments
  • 2024-04-16 Approved for Consideration Assignments
  • 2024-04-16 Rule 2-10 Third Reading Deadline Established As May 3, 2024
  • 2024-04-16 Placed on Calendar Order of 3rd Reading April 17, 2024
  • 2024-04-17 Senate Floor Amendment No. 1 Filed with Secretary by Sen. Linda Holmes amendment-introduction
  • 2024-04-17 Senate Floor Amendment No. 1 Referred to Assignments
  • 2024-04-17 Senate Floor Amendment No. 1 Assignments Refers to State Government
  • 2024-04-17 Chief Sponsor Changed to Sen. Linda Holmes
  • 2024-04-18 Senate Floor Amendment No. 1 Recommend Do Adopt State Government; 008-000-000
  • 2024-04-18 Recalled to Second Reading reading-2
  • 2024-04-18 Senate Floor Amendment No. 1 Adopted amendment-passage
  • 2024-04-18 Placed on Calendar Order of 3rd Reading
  • 2024-04-18 Third Reading - Passed; 057-000-000 passage, reading-3
  • 2024-04-18 Arrived in House introduction
  • 2024-04-18 Chief House Sponsor Rep. Emanuel "Chris" Welch
  • 2024-04-18 First Reading reading-1
  • 2024-04-18 Referred to Rules Committee
  • 2024-04-18 Alternate Chief Sponsor Changed to Rep. Natalie A. Manley
  • 2024-04-30 Assigned to Energy & Environment Committee referral-committee
  • 2024-04-30 Committee Deadline Extended-Rule 9(b) May 10, 2024
  • 2024-05-07 Do Pass / Short Debate Energy & Environment Committee; 026-000-000
  • 2024-05-08 Placed on Calendar 2nd Reading - Short Debate reading-2
  • 2024-05-13 Second Reading - Short Debate reading-2
  • 2024-05-13 Placed on Calendar Order of 3rd Reading - Short Debate
  • 2024-05-17 Third Reading/Final Action Deadline Extended-9(b) May 24, 2024
  • 2024-05-23 Third Reading - Short Debate - Passed 111-000-000 passage, reading-3
  • 2024-05-23 Passed Both Houses
  • 2024-05-23 Added Alternate Chief Co-Sponsor Rep. Dan Ugaste
  • 2024-06-21 Sent to the Governor executive-receipt
  • 2024-08-09 Governor Approved executive-signature
  • 2024-08-09 Effective Date January 1, 2025
  • 2024-08-09 Public Act . . . . . . . . . 103-0887 became-law
